On Tue, Dec 18, 2012 at 7:34 PM, Kyle Mestery (kmestery) <[email protected] > wrote: > On Dec 18, 2012, at 8:30 AM, Ahmed Talha Khan <[email protected]> wrote: > > > > How do i use them if they are not on the host? I mean these are not > eth0/eth1 type actual interfaces, so how will they be visible on the host > until i make some device myself? How do you propose that I add the port. > > > > The easiest way is this: > > ovs-vsctl add-port br0 port0 -- set Interface port0 type=internal > > In that example, you will see a "port0" interface if you do "ifconfig > port0". Create another one (port1 maybe) and you can then run your tests on > those ports, once you do "ifconfig port0/port1 up". > > > > > On Tue, Dec 18, 2012 at 7:22 PM, Kyle Mestery (kmestery) < > [email protected]> wrote: > > On Dec 18, 2012, at 8:19 AM, Ahmed Talha Khan <[email protected]> wrote: > > > > > > I am not aware of the internal port functionality. Can you kindly > elaborate your answer a bit more. Also what do you mean by "add IP > configuration on your bridge port"? How will that help in sending traffic > in? > > > > > Internal ports are internal ports created in OVS on the bridge. You can > use them on the host itself for different purposes, one of which is you can > apply IP configuration onto them. For the VXLAN testing I did, I would use > this functionality, for example. If you test does not require IP, then just > configure the port up and send traffic into it.
